Role Description Arcadis is currently searching for a Senior Architect to join our Water Business line team in our Columbus, Ohio office. This is an exciting opportunity for a self-motivated Senior Architect to join our team in Columbus Ohio office with support from one of the best-qualified municipal consulting firms in the country. Senior Architect, with the support of a strong nationally recognized technical staff, will utilize their expertise and technical knowledge of architectural design to lead and deliver successful projects within the Water/Wastewater Industry and help lead and grow our team.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's Degree in Architecture or a related field of study.
  • Professional Architectural certification.
  • Ability to exercise their own judgment on details of work and in making preliminary selections and adaptations of engineering alternatives.
  • Excellent communication skills, both oral and written. Skills to include; public speaking, ability to work as part of a team, preparation and development of technical documents, prior client involvement and/or relationship skills as part of the project team.
  • Functional knowledge and experience with AutoCAD/REVIT software and MS Office applications.
  • Experience with W/WW industry and building codes and standards such as IBC, etc.

Responsibilities

  • Lead code reviews and investigations and production of construction drawings, specifications, bid packages, and cost estimates for projects.
  • Manage and mentor junior architectural staff. Work effectively in team situations and establish strong relationships with other team and project members.
  • Lead development of plans, specifications, requests for proposals, and other contract documents.
  • Work directly with a variety of engineering disciplines, office / project staff, client and sub-contractors, throughout the project life cycle, and therefore should have clear and concise, oral and written communication skills with a demonstrated ability to coordinate meetings, conduct effective client presentations and prepare written reports.
  • Assist with construction administration and submittal review of architectural items and feasibility review of alternative design approaches.
